Transaction 25593b34885d618ee9024be522b98ad40b8dba156d65188ccfc96d0f06189acf
1 Input
1 Output
-
25593b34885d618ee9024be522b98ad40b8dba156d65188ccfc96d0f06189acf:0
- value
- 27231319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3698eb04df3fa06dead4f5045ac175f16d3af64d OP_EQUAL
- address
- 36fhbqMWF1yADhXuM7NDv3yQihYjZ5UBGM